胸腺是动物体内最早形成的淋巴器官,其基质由上皮细胞组成,胸腺的上皮细胞能合成和分泌胸腺激素。胸腺及其分泌的激素,对T淋巴细胞的正常分化成熟、对淋巴系统功能的调节、免疫稳定性的维持及免疫监管等方面都具有重要的作用。随着年龄的增长,胸腺逐渐萎缩,胸腺激素水平亦逐渐降低,免疫功能随之下降。本实验对不同日龄小鼠胸腺重量作了一些观察和比较。材料和方法 1.小鼠来源:从成都生物制品所购回昆明种小鼠。在本院动物房饲养、繁殖。 2.胸腺组织标本的选取:各窝雌雄小鼠,记录出生日期。分别在10、20、30、37、44、51、58以及300天,随机分出部份小鼠,称重后,断头、立即解剖,取出胸腺,用泸纸吸去胸腺上的液体。在组织天平上称取胸腺的重量,换算成每100克小鼠体重之胸腺毫
